The street in brief

Cotton Close is a mix of detached houses and ter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£253,750 — roughly 28% below the OX12 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£3,464, below the district's £3,676.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across OX12 prices have been easing over the last few years. The record shows 16 sales across 7 homes since 2004.

Cotton Close's £253,750 median sits about 28% below OX12's £350,000; on floor space it runs £3,464/m² against the district's £3,676/m² (-6%).

Street and OX12 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
